Freigeben über


definition von resources.containers.container.trigger

Gibt die Triggerbedingungen für eine Containerressource an.

Definitionen, die auf diese Definition verweisen: resources.containers.container

Implementierungen

Implementierung Beschreibung
Trigger: aktiviert, Tags Geben Sie eine Liste von Tags an, für die ausgelöst werden soll.
Trigger: keine | STIMMT Geben Sie keine zum Deaktivieren oder true an, um für alle Bildtags auszulösen.

Bemerkungen

Geben Sie none to disable, true an, um für alle Bildtags auszulösen, oder verwenden Sie die vollständige Syntax, wie in den folgenden Beispielen beschrieben.

Trigger: aktiviert, Tags

Konfigurieren Sie, welche Tags eine Ausführung auslösen.

trigger:
  enabled: boolean # Whether the trigger is enabled; defaults to true.
  tags: includeExcludeStringFilters | [ string ] # Tag names to include or exclude for triggering a run.

Eigenschaften

enabledBoolescher Wert.
Gibt an, ob der Trigger aktiviert ist; ist standardmäßig auf true festgelegt.

tagsincludeExcludeStringFilters.
Tagnamen, die zum Auslösen einer Ausführung eingeschlossen oder ausgeschlossen werden sollen.

Beispiele

Im folgenden Beispiel ist der Trigger für Tags aktiviert, die übereinstimmen production*.

resources:         
  containers:
  - container: petStore      
    type: ACR  
    azureSubscription: ContosoARMConnection
    resourceGroup: ContosoGroup
    registry: petStoreRegistry
    repository: myPets
    trigger: 
      tags:
        include: 
        - production*

Trigger: keine | STIMMT

Geben Sie keine zum Deaktivieren oder true an, um für alle Bildtags auszulösen.

trigger: none | true # Specify none to disable or true to trigger on all image tags.

trigger Schnur. Zulässige Werte: keine | STIMMT.

Geben Sie keine zum Deaktivieren oder true an, um für alle Bildtags auszulösen.

Bemerkungen

Geben Sie an none , um den Trigger zu deaktivieren oder true zu aktivieren. Ohne Angabe wird standardmäßig none verwendet. Informationen zum Konfigurieren von Triggern basierend auf bestimmten Tags finden Sie im folgenden Abschnitt.

Beispiele

resources:         
  containers:
  - container: petStore      
    type: ACR  
    azureSubscription: ContosoARMConnection
    resourceGroup: ContosoGroup
    registry: petStoreRegistry
    repository: myPets
    trigger: 
      tags: none # Triggers disabled
resources:         
  containers:
  - container: petStore      
    type: ACR  
    azureSubscription: ContosoARMConnection
    resourceGroup: ContosoGroup
    registry: petStoreRegistry
    repository: myPets
    trigger: 
      tags: true # Triggers enabled for all tags

Weitere Informationen